Imagine, if you will, the universe as a whole. Now, once a scientist claimed that "For every action, there is an equal and opposite reaction." This also applies to the concepts of good and evil. Now, think about the "Sailor Moon" universe. Sailor Moon and the Sailor Scouts stand for what is good and pure in this galaxy. You could almost say that this galaxy is heavily influenced by good. However, what would occur if a galaxy was influenced the other way? A whole new generation of Scouts are about to find this out.
